fixing check sso
This commit is contained in:
parent
e37934c9f2
commit
8dd852aeeb
1 changed files with 23 additions and 24 deletions
|
|
@ -161,9 +161,6 @@ onMounted(async () => {
|
|||
deleteCookie("BMAHRISCKI_KEYCLOAK_IDENTITY");
|
||||
deleteCookie("BMAHRISUSER_KEYCLOAK_IDENTITY");
|
||||
|
||||
const checkToken = await getCookie(cookieTokenName.value);
|
||||
|
||||
if (!checkToken && !token.value) {
|
||||
await axios
|
||||
.post(
|
||||
`${config.API.sso}/kcauth`,
|
||||
|
|
@ -177,6 +174,7 @@ onMounted(async () => {
|
|||
)
|
||||
.then(async (res: any) => {
|
||||
if (res.status === 200) {
|
||||
if (res.data.access_token) {
|
||||
setCookie(cookieTokenName.value, res.data.access_token, 1);
|
||||
setCookie(cookieTokenRefName.value, res.data.refresh_token, 1);
|
||||
|
||||
|
|
@ -185,15 +183,16 @@ onMounted(async () => {
|
|||
|
||||
// ยิง log เข้าระบบ
|
||||
await postSaveLog("เข้าสู่ระบบ", res.data.access_token);
|
||||
} else if (res.data.isLogin) {
|
||||
token.value = await getCookie(cookieTokenName.value);
|
||||
refreshToken.value = await getCookie(cookieTokenRefName.value);
|
||||
}
|
||||
}
|
||||
})
|
||||
.catch((err: any) => {
|
||||
router.push("/sso");
|
||||
});
|
||||
} else {
|
||||
token.value = await getCookie(cookieTokenName.value);
|
||||
refreshToken.value = await getCookie(cookieTokenRefName.value);
|
||||
}
|
||||
|
||||
getName();
|
||||
});
|
||||
</script>
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ue